How do I maintain eco-products for maximum longevity?
Extend product life with these practices:
- Charging Care:
- Use only provided adapters
- Avoid full discharges
- Cleaning Protocol:
- Cold water rinsing saves energy
- Plant-based cleaners
- Storage:
- Partial charge for storage
- Climate-controlled environments
Maintenance schedule:
- Monthly deep cleaning
- Biannual contact checks
- Annual battery calibration
Can I trust 'green' claims in pleasure product marketing?
Verify through our certification system:
- Third-Party Certifications - Look for ISO 14024 Type 1 labels
- Supply Chain Transparency - Full material traceability
- Lifecycle Assessments - Published environmental impact reports
